ASSITEJ: Festival of British Children's Theatre, International Children's Theatre Conference, London, 1964

 File — Box: 5, Folder: 1
Scope and Content Note From the collection: The Ann Stahlman Hill Papers document the career of this Nashville-based set and costume designer, writer, arts administrator, and arts in education advocate's mostly volunteer work in theatre for young audiences and arts education from 1956 through 2014. Included are: speeches, articles by and about Hill, business correspondence, and theatre for youth organizational records. It is divided into the following six series: Biographical; Speeches; Articles; Theatre Associations' Work; Arts...
Dates: 1964
